NHS Grampian is seeking to appoint a Primary Care Lead who can be from the AHP, Nursing or medical professions, to join the Grampian Stroke Managed Clinical Network (MCN). The hours of work are to be negotiated with the successful applicant and flexible or consolidated patterns will be considered (weekly, fortnightly or monthly) with an average of approximately 10-12 hours per month.

Applicants should have knowledge and experience in the provision and development of stroke services. Applicants should also have good knowledge and experience of primary care services in Grampian. Working closely with the Stroke MCN Clinical Lead and being a key part of the stroke core team you will support implementation of evidence based practice; play a key role in the monitoring of clinical standards; promote the development of stroke care pathways that support equitable access to services across Grampian, raise issues with regards to stroke pathway from colleagues in primary care and contribute to the Strategic planning of services. Particular areas of focus for this role will be stroke prevention/risk factors, pathways back into primary care as part of rehabilitation after stroke, and TIAs.

Applicants will be motivating, engaging and demonstrate commitment to the role of the Stroke MCN in delivering improvements in care across Grampian. The ability to work across the organisation and with partners is essential to manage change within a complex environment.
